What affects the price

When you get a quote for landscaping, the final number depends on a few moving parts. The total square footage of your yard is the biggest factor, followed by the specific types of plants, hardscaping materials, or irrigation systems you choose. If your property requires significant grading, clearing away heavy debris, or accessibility challenges for our equipment, those tasks add labor hours. About this service

A landscaping supplier is a business that sells bulk materials like mulch, soil, gravel, and pavers. You need one when you are taking on a DIY project and need to haul materials to your property yourself. What are the 7 types of landscapes?

Common landscape styles include formal, informal, English, Japanese, cottage, desert, and modern. Each offers a distinct aesthetic and requires specific plant choices. Understanding these can help you articulate your vision for your Jersey City property to the pros.
